Electric is a leading online destination for modern, contemporary art. We showcase a mix of limited edition prints, original works and photography.

Bench Allen

Bench Allan is a London-based illustrator who is fascinated by natural history. His work is inspired by the natural – and unnatural – world.

Originally from Plymouth in South West England, the artist explores the worlds of “wordless narrative”, leaving his work open to interpretation but with a consistent grounding to nature.

Bench works as a print maker at Jealous Gallery in Shoreditch and lists comedian as a professional credential. We’re not sure if he’s joking.